In a heartfelt message of solidarity, Ousmane Sonko, President of the National Assembly, conveyed his deepest condolences following the demise of Serigne Abdou Bakhi Mbacké, the esteemed Khalife of the Khassim Mbacké family in Guinguinéo, Senegal. The respected religious leader passed away on July 9, 2026.
In a poignant post on Facebook, Sonko honored the memory of the late spiritual guide, extending his sympathies to the bereaved family, the General Khalife of the Mouride Brotherhood, and the entire Senegalese people. His tribute reflected profound sorrow and respect for the late Khalife.
Sonko recalled the meaningful interactions he had with Serigne Abdou Bakhi Mbacké during his visits to Guinguinéo, emphasizing the warmth and hospitality extended by the revered religious figure. « Each encounter left a lasting impression, marked by his kindness and generosity, » he wrote.
In this time of mourning, Sonko offered his « most sincere condolences » to the family, the Mouride community, and all citizens of Senegal. His message concluded with a prayer, invoking divine mercy and eternal peace for the departed soul.
« May Allah, in His boundless compassion, grant him forgiveness and welcome him into His eternal paradise, » he prayed.
